Syria participates in Minsk International Book Fair

Syria participated in the Minsk International Book Fair, which is held from the 23rd to the 27th  of March under the slogan “The Flow of the History of the Nation.”

Syria’s pavilion in this year’s exhibition, which was organized by the Russian Embassy in Minsk with the participation of the branch of the National Union of Syrian Students in Belarus, included a set of cultural and tourism books, publications and brochures available at the embassy in both Arabic and Russian, in addition to some paintings, photos, handicrafts and traditional clothing that expresses Syria’s history and civilization.

Belarusian Minister of Foreign Affairs Vladimir Makei, Minister of Information Vladimir Bertsov, Minister of Education Andrei Ivanets and Deputy Director of the Presidential Administration Maxim Raginkov visited the pavilion. They expressed their admiration for its exhibits, wishing to continue and enhance participation in the coming year.

Syria’s ambassador to Belarus, Muhammad Al-Amrani, stressed the importance of strengthening cultural and economic relations and raising them to the level of solid political relations between the two friendly countries.

A number of ambassadors and heads of diplomatic missions accredited in Minsk, along with a large number of Belarusian citizens visited the pavilion.

Besides Syria, 222 publishing houses from 12 countries and a number of embassies accredited in the Belarusian capital participated in the exhibition.
